Player experience

Just finished "The Last Of Us" version 1.11, serial BCUS98174 without any crash or hang once I configured the RPCS3 with the help from a Youtube Video from "Santiago Santiago".

Though the framerate dropped terribly to 12 FPS at times, yet the game was absolutely playable till the very end. Max FPS I reached is about 28-30 FPS. But the AVERAGE framerate was about 16-20 FPS throughout the game. Since many of us have been playing games on Intel's integrated graphics, at least I am pretty much used to play games at low FPS. And this game is absolutely playable at least on my current hardware.

My PC Specs : Ryzen 5 3600, Nvidia RTX 2060 Super and 1 x 16GB RAM stick.

Plus, do not forget to apply game patches also shown in the video, configuration part.

I forgot to apply the "Enable GPU Lighting" in the patch and there were several black boxes every here and there in the Prologue. But once I checked it ON, the magic happened and the game ran absolutely fine till the very end without any crash or hang at all.
